Questions Business Owners Ask When Reviewing Contact Form Reassurance

What reassurance belongs directly above a contact form?

State who will respond, the expected time frame, how the information will be used, and whether the inquiry creates any obligation. Keep it specific to the practice process. Are fewer fields always better?

No. A field is worthwhile when it helps the practice respond accurately or protects the cautious prospect from an unnecessary back-and-forth. Remove questions that serve only internal curiosity. How should optional fields be presented?

Label them clearly and explain the benefit of answering when the reason is not obvious. Visitors should never have to guess which information is required. What should happen after a form is submitted?

Show a confirmation that repeats the next step and response expectation. When appropriate, provide a phone number or scheduling option for urgent situations.
